I would like to especially thank all the unnamed heroes who made this dream a reality: the health workers, who day-in and day-out have vaccinated children not only in health facilities, but also in the most difficult-to-access areas of each country. Let me also thank those who have been dedicated to completing the noble task of researching each case until interrupting the endemic transmission of this virus, even under extremely difficult conditions... Now is the moment to implement all the necessary actions to avoid the reestablishment of endemic transmission of this deadly virus: we must strengthen epidemiological surveillance systems and maintain high vaccination coverage against measles and rubella through a strong routine immunization program and high quality vaccination campaigns. This will only be possible if within the Member States and PAHO, we sustain our commitment and leadership, as well as a wide coordination with our partners, allowing health workers to continue with their tireless efforts to improve the health of our populations.
